Eight-try St Helens eye another final

Defending champions St Helens ran in eight tries to beat Catalans Dragons 42-8 on Sunday to reach the Challenge Cup quarter-finals.

Francis Meli, Paul Wellens and Gary Wheeler all scored two tries each as Saints moved within two games of a fourth successive final appearance.

Paul Clough and Leon Pryce also touched down for the Super League leaders, who will now travel to Gateshead in the quarter-finals.

Super League Hull KR saw off Sheffield 34-24 and will now play Warrington, one of three top-flight sides - along with Huddersfield and Salford - who enjoyed comfortable victories over lower-division opposition.

Richie Mathers marked his debut with two of Warrington's 10 tries in a 56-8 defeat of Featherstone.

Shaun Lunt scored a hat-trick as Huddersfield, who now face Castleford, eased past Rochdale 38-12.

Mark Henry scored four tries as Salford booked a date with Wigan with a 66-4 crushing of Batley.
